Definition

Hurdling is a track and field sport where athletes run and jump over a series of barriers called hurdles. It also refers to the action of jumping over hurdles in races.

Usage & Nuances

Mostly used in sports contexts, especially athletics/track and field. 'Hurdling' can also be used metaphorically for overcoming obstacles, but this is less common. Typical collocations: '100m hurdling', 'hurdling event', 'practice hurdling'.
